### Strategies For Decoding

When faced with a mystery sequence, professionals should avoid random guessing and instead utilize systematic verification methods. The internet and internal documentation are valuable resources for transforming a jumble from a puzzle into a piece of data. Treat the number as a keyword to search for rather than a riddle to solve.

**Internal Resources**

Most organizations maintain internal wikis or knowledge bases that catalog common system messages and error codes. Searching the company intranet for "81525" might yield immediate results. If the jumble appeared within a specific software dashboard, consulting the user manual for that specific application is the fastest path to understanding.

**External Verification**

If internal searches fail, the jumble may originate from a third-party service, such as a payment gateway or a cloud storage provider. In these scenarios, support forums or help centers are the best next step. While the specific string "81525" may not be public, the category of the error (e.g., payment failure, sync error) can often be identified by searching for symptoms rather than the code itself.

**Best Practices For Prevention**

While not all jumbles can be prevented, organizations can reduce their frequency through standardized communication protocols.

* **Clear Labeling:** Ensure that all system-generated codes are prefixed with a clear identifier (e.g., `ERROR_81525` or `REF_81525`).

* **Data Validation:** Implement checks that prevent raw, unformatted numbers from appearing in user-facing fields without context.

* **Training:** Educate staff on the importance of documenting unusual sequences immediately so that IT teams can investigate the root cause.
